Operations Assistant II - Warehouse Operations

Location: Doral, FL

Your role in our success will be...

Assists and supports the Manager and Supervisors in maintaining efficient and effective daily operations, including warehousing, inventory support, administration of packing slips, invoicing, allocating and accounting charges, accruals, records management, and report generation. Supports the warehouse team with material (inventory and non-inventory) needs and vendor relations. Performs administrative tasks requiring independent judgment and familiarity with business operations and material applications.

What you'll be working on...
  1. Processing inbound invoices, scanning matching packing slips with invoices, coding/allocating charges to proper accounts for all divisions.
  2. Reviewing accuracy and completeness of vendor invoices, verifying vendor, amount, general ledger, coding, and sales tax.
  3. Supporting warehouse technicians in processing and entering inventory-related receipts, charges, and POs via E4SE / 1CX system.
  4. Creating purchase requisitions, scanning/uploading related images, and coding in Doc-Link for routing and approvals.
  5. Supporting the warehouse team with E4SE inventory system needs, including product identification, codes, costs, and data management.
  6. Assisting in warehouse inventory audits.
  7. Recommending improvements to inventory and accounts payable processes.
  8. Tracking inventory and non-inventory stock levels, vendor costs, etc.
  9. Supporting monthly accrual reporting and pending invoice identification.
  10. Responding promptly and professionally to employee and vendor inquiries.
  11. Managing storage and retrieval of records.
  12. Processing P-card charges and allocations.
  13. Performing invoicing, record filing, and asset management tasks.
  14. Downloading meter readings and preparing monthly reports.
  15. Performing data entry for compliance and supporting technicians.
  16. Completing accounts payable monthly close tasks.
Who you are...
  • High School Diploma or equivalent.
  • At least three years of clerical/office experience.
  • Valid Florida Driver's License.
  • Proficiency with spreadsheets, MS Office, SAP, and FPU databases.
  • Knowledge of basic inventory procedures.
  • Understanding of natural gas materials and tools.
  • Excellent communication skills.
  • Strong clerical, writing, and math skills.
  • Ability to understand and apply accounting principles.
